## Service Accounts: Record Dedupe Worker

The svc-dedupe account merges duplicate customer records nightly via the Claspline matching API. It holds read/write on the customer table only — never grant billing scope, as merges would cascade into invoices. If the worker stalls, check the lock table before restarting. On-call may re-authenticate the worker manually using the key below.

service key, fawip-bajef: kto11_Qt5wZK9vdNC

Action item: The Relayn deploy-status bot silently dropped updates when the pipeline API paginated results, so responders believed a rollback had completed when it had not. We will add pagination handling, a staleness banner, and an integration test. Until merged, verify deploy state directly in the pipeline console, documented at the page below.

runbook for kahop-kajop: https://rundeck.ordinio.test/display/secrets/pipeline/issue/pages/repo/browse/e5732776e07d1285107e5aeb

### Runbook: Report export timezone mismatches (Glimmerfield)

If a customer reports that exported totals differ from the dashboard, check whether their report schedule predates the March cutover — older schedules still render in server-local time rather than the account timezone. Re-saving the schedule fixes it. Before escalating, confirm the export worker is running with the expected timezone settings shown below.

config for kadup-kajog:
[raldor]
host = raldor.tolvaqworks.internal
user = raldor_svc
database = raldor_prod